Memory Foam Mattress Pads--questions

Thinking of replacing my feather bed (from QVC) with a Beautyrest memory foam mattress pad (from Kohl's). Questions if you have one or something similar: Are they hot? Do you have to turn them like you do a featherbed or do they "bounce back"? Are you happy with your purchase? Thanks for the help.

Re: Memory Foam Mattress Pads--questions

I've used memory foam toppers for years. I've never had a problem with feeling hot at all, although some people have such complaints. I do use a nice mattress pad on mine. As soon as you get off of it, the memory foam returns to its original shape. I do turn mine about once every three months just so it'll wear evenly.

I've gotten all my toppers from Overstock.com. They have a large selection and are the only place of which I'm aware that lists the density of the foam on each item. I like the 4lb density that does't "give" too much. I love sleeping on these toppers.
